Please follow the steps below to successfully install your Lexmark X1185 printer on your computer:
Download the printer driver on your computer. Visit the Lexmark website at http://bit.ly/hpZeUq.
Select your operating system > click on "FILTER" > click on the driver under Recommended Downloads > download and execute the file.
Simply follow the instructions on your computer screen.

You can download the Lexmark X1185 driver from the Lexmark website for free. Click on this link Lexmark X1185 Drivers. Select your operating system to download the driver. NOTE: Use Vista driver in Windows 7.
